Also adding that software only being inflexible due to being mass-produced is the state of the pre-Enshittification era that we already left behind. Since the last decade or so at the latest, software is often designed as an explicit means of power over users and applications are made deliberately inflexible to, e.g. corece users to watch ads, purchase goods or services or simply stay at the screen for longer than intended. (Even that was already the case in niches, especially "shareware". But in a sense, all commercial software is shareware now) |
